Overview
Making mistakes is human. But when doctors make mistakes, it often has far-reaching consequences. Frans Bromet speaks with doctors who have made serious medical errors. Talking about mistakes is by no means a matter of course within the medical profession. The trust that the patient places in the doctor proves to be a great asset. Betraying that trust is a devastating experience for the medical professionals. Yet they are willing to speak openly ‘because otherwise you deny the patient and their family the opportunity to understand, to process what has happened.’ But above all, because you can only learn from mistakes by making them open for discussion. Only then can hospitals actually take measures or implement improvements.
